Infrared spectrophotometric determination of the alkalinity of overbased petroleum sulphonates
Abstract
A simple, rapid and selective infrared spectrophotometric method was used to determine the alkalinity of the overbased calcium sulphonate additives. The intensities of the absorbance of the bands at 865 and 1180 cm–1, assigned to the δCO32– and νas SO vibrations, respectively, in the same spectrum of the overbased sulphonate sample were measured. The absorbance ratio method was applied as the path length was not known.
